Rajasthan Royals captain Riyan Parag won the toss and opted to bowl against Mumbai Indians in the 50th match of the Indian Premier League (IPL) 2025, taking place at Sawai Mansingh Stadium in Jaipur. As Sports Tak earlier reported, RR skipper Sanju Samson is missing the clash against MI and apart from Samson, Sandeep Sharma is also missing the clash as he has broken his finger before the clash. 

 RR are coming after registering a dominating win in their last clash against Gujarat Titans (RR), the franchise looks to repeat the same in the clash against MI. On the other hand, MI are making a comeback in the ongoing edition after getting a poor start. The Hardik Pandya-led side has won their last five consecutive matches, and they will be confident enough to register their sixth. 

MI vs RR IPL head-to-head

MI and RR have faced each other in 30 matches in the IPL. Out of these 30 games, MI have won 15, whereas RR have come out victorious on 14 occasions. 1 match ended without a result. This is their first outing against each other in IPL 2025.

Captains at Toss

Hardik Pandya (MI) captain: We would've bowled first as well. It has always been about how we can play good cricket. The conversation was always about how we can get better, we've spoken about the same and nothing changes. We want to be fearless and not let fear of failure kick in. Don't decide how much we need to put on, have a set marker but we need to analzye the wicket. Quite confident about batting on this wicket. There hasn't been much dew around. We go with the same team.

Riyan Parag (RR) captain: We'll bowl first. We might see some dew later. Usually the wicket settles down a little later at night. Want to exploit that. We've kept it very simple regardless of winning or losing. Rahul sir has made it clear, we keep it simple whether we go high or low. Three games ago, the message was we take it one game at a time. If we play to our potential, we know how good we can be. Just want to give everyone the freedom to play their game. Couple of changes, Hasaranga has a niggle, Kumar Kartikeya comes in, Sandy (Sandeep Sharma) bhai has broken his finger so Madhwal comes in.

 

MI vs RR playing XIs

Mumbai Indians (Playing XI): Ryan Rickelton(w), Rohit Sharma, Will Jacks, Suryakumar Yadav, Tilak Varma, Hardik Pandya(c), Naman Dhir, Corbin Bosch, Deepak Chahar, Trent Boult, Jasprit Bumrah


Rajasthan Royals (Playing XI): Yashasvi Jaiswal, Vaibhav Suryavanshi, Nitish Rana, Riyan Parag(c), Dhruv Jurel(w), Shimron Hetmyer, Jofra Archer, Maheesh Theekshana, Kumar Kartikeya, Akash Madhwal, Fazalhaq Farooqi
 

Here are the Impact substitutes for both teams:

Mumbai Indians Impact Subs: Raj Bawa, Satyanarayana Raju, Robin Minz, Reece Topley, Karn Sharma

Rajasthan Royals Impact Subs: Shubham Dubey, Tushar Deshpande, Kunal Singh Rathore, Yudhvir Singh Charak, Kwena Maphaka
